194 lines
5.0 KiB
JSON
194 lines
5.0 KiB
JSON
|
{
|
||
|
"_from": "@noble/curves@1.4.2",
|
||
|
"_id": "@noble/curves@1.4.2",
|
||
|
"_inBundle": false,
|
||
|
"_integrity": "sha512-TavHr8qycMChk8UwMld0ZDRvatedkzWfH8IiaeGCfymOP5i0hSCozz9vHOL0nkwk7HRMlFnAiKpS2jrUmSybcw==",
|
||
|
"_location": "/@noble/curves",
|
||
|
"_phantomChildren": {},
|
||
|
"_requested": {
|
||
|
"type": "version",
|
||
|
"registry": true,
|
||
|
"raw": "@noble/curves@1.4.2",
|
||
|
"name": "@noble/curves",
|
||
|
"escapedName": "@noble%2fcurves",
|
||
|
"scope": "@noble",
|
||
|
"rawSpec": "1.4.2",
|
||
|
"saveSpec": null,
|
||
|
"fetchSpec": "1.4.2"
|
||
|
},
|
||
|
"_requiredBy": [
|
||
|
"/@ethereumjs/util/ethereum-cryptography",
|
||
|
"/@scure/bip32",
|
||
|
"/web3-utils/ethereum-cryptography"
|
||
|
],
|
||
|
"_resolved": "https://registry.npmmirror.com/@noble/curves/-/curves-1.4.2.tgz",
|
||
|
"_shasum": "40309198c76ed71bc6dbf7ba24e81ceb4d0d1fe9",
|
||
|
"_spec": "@noble/curves@1.4.2",
|
||
|
"_where": "D:\\ruyi\\dapp\\node_modules\\@ethereumjs\\util\\node_modules\\ethereum-cryptography",
|
||
|
"author": {
|
||
|
"name": "Paul Miller",
|
||
|
"url": "https://paulmillr.com"
|
||
|
},
|
||
|
"bugs": {
|
||
|
"url": "https://github.com/paulmillr/noble-curves/issues"
|
||
|
},
|
||
|
"bundleDependencies": false,
|
||
|
"dependencies": {
|
||
|
"@noble/hashes": "1.4.0"
|
||
|
},
|
||
|
"deprecated": false,
|
||
|
"description": "Audited & minimal JS implementation of elliptic curve cryptography",
|
||
|
"devDependencies": {
|
||
|
"@paulmillr/jsbt": "0.2.1",
|
||
|
"fast-check": "3.0.0",
|
||
|
"micro-bmark": "0.3.1",
|
||
|
"micro-should": "0.4.0",
|
||
|
"prettier": "3.3.2",
|
||
|
"typescript": "5.5.2"
|
||
|
},
|
||
|
"exports": {
|
||
|
".": {
|
||
|
"import": "./esm/index.js",
|
||
|
"require": "./index.js"
|
||
|
},
|
||
|
"./abstract/edwards": {
|
||
|
"import": "./esm/abstract/edwards.js",
|
||
|
"require": "./abstract/edwards.js"
|
||
|
},
|
||
|
"./abstract/modular": {
|
||
|
"import": "./esm/abstract/modular.js",
|
||
|
"require": "./abstract/modular.js"
|
||
|
},
|
||
|
"./abstract/montgomery": {
|
||
|
"import": "./esm/abstract/montgomery.js",
|
||
|
"require": "./abstract/montgomery.js"
|
||
|
},
|
||
|
"./abstract/weierstrass": {
|
||
|
"import": "./esm/abstract/weierstrass.js",
|
||
|
"require": "./abstract/weierstrass.js"
|
||
|
},
|
||
|
"./abstract/bls": {
|
||
|
"import": "./esm/abstract/bls.js",
|
||
|
"require": "./abstract/bls.js"
|
||
|
},
|
||
|
"./abstract/hash-to-curve": {
|
||
|
"import": "./esm/abstract/hash-to-curve.js",
|
||
|
"require": "./abstract/hash-to-curve.js"
|
||
|
},
|
||
|
"./abstract/curve": {
|
||
|
"import": "./esm/abstract/curve.js",
|
||
|
"require": "./abstract/curve.js"
|
||
|
},
|
||
|
"./abstract/utils": {
|
||
|
"import": "./esm/abstract/utils.js",
|
||
|
"require": "./abstract/utils.js"
|
||
|
},
|
||
|
"./abstract/poseidon": {
|
||
|
"import": "./esm/abstract/poseidon.js",
|
||
|
"require": "./abstract/poseidon.js"
|
||
|
},
|
||
|
"./_shortw_utils": {
|
||
|
"import": "./esm/_shortw_utils.js",
|
||
|
"require": "./_shortw_utils.js"
|
||
|
},
|
||
|
"./bls12-381": {
|
||
|
"import": "./esm/bls12-381.js",
|
||
|
"require": "./bls12-381.js"
|
||
|
},
|
||
|
"./bn254": {
|
||
|
"import": "./esm/bn254.js",
|
||
|
"require": "./bn254.js"
|
||
|
},
|
||
|
"./ed25519": {
|
||
|
"import": "./esm/ed25519.js",
|
||
|
"require": "./ed25519.js"
|
||
|
},
|
||
|
"./ed448": {
|
||
|
"import": "./esm/ed448.js",
|
||
|
"require": "./ed448.js"
|
||
|
},
|
||
|
"./index": {
|
||
|
"import": "./esm/index.js",
|
||
|
"require": "./index.js"
|
||
|
},
|
||
|
"./jubjub": {
|
||
|
"import": "./esm/jubjub.js",
|
||
|
"require": "./jubjub.js"
|
||
|
},
|
||
|
"./p256": {
|
||
|
"import": "./esm/p256.js",
|
||
|
"require": "./p256.js"
|
||
|
},
|
||
|
"./p384": {
|
||
|
"import": "./esm/p384.js",
|
||
|
"require": "./p384.js"
|
||
|
},
|
||
|
"./p521": {
|
||
|
"import": "./esm/p521.js",
|
||
|
"require": "./p521.js"
|
||
|
},
|
||
|
"./pasta": {
|
||
|
"import": "./esm/pasta.js",
|
||
|
"require": "./pasta.js"
|
||
|
},
|
||
|
"./secp256k1": {
|
||
|
"import": "./esm/secp256k1.js",
|
||
|
"require": "./secp256k1.js"
|
||
|
}
|
||
|
},
|
||
|
"files": [
|
||
|
"abstract",
|
||
|
"esm",
|
||
|
"src",
|
||
|
"*.js",
|
||
|
"*.js.map",
|
||
|
"*.d.ts",
|
||
|
"*.d.ts.map"
|
||
|
],
|
||
|
"funding": "https://paulmillr.com/funding/",
|
||
|
"homepage": "https://paulmillr.com/noble/",
|
||
|
"keywords": [
|
||
|
"elliptic",
|
||
|
"curve",
|
||
|
"cryptography",
|
||
|
"secp256k1",
|
||
|
"ed25519",
|
||
|
"p256",
|
||
|
"p384",
|
||
|
"p521",
|
||
|
"secp256r1",
|
||
|
"ed448",
|
||
|
"x25519",
|
||
|
"ed25519",
|
||
|
"bls12-381",
|
||
|
"bn254",
|
||
|
"bls",
|
||
|
"noble",
|
||
|
"ecc",
|
||
|
"ecdsa",
|
||
|
"eddsa",
|
||
|
"weierstrass",
|
||
|
"montgomery",
|
||
|
"edwards",
|
||
|
"schnorr"
|
||
|
],
|
||
|
"license": "MIT",
|
||
|
"main": "index.js",
|
||
|
"name": "@noble/curves",
|
||
|
"repository": {
|
||
|
"type": "git",
|
||
|
"url": "git+https://github.com/paulmillr/noble-curves.git"
|
||
|
},
|
||
|
"scripts": {
|
||
|
"bench": "cd benchmark; node secp256k1.js; node curves.js; node ecdh.js; node hash-to-curve.js; node modular.js; node bls.js; node ristretto255.js; node decaf448.js",
|
||
|
"build": "tsc && tsc -p tsconfig.esm.json",
|
||
|
"build:clean": "rm *.{js,d.ts,d.ts.map,js.map} esm/*.{js,d.ts,d.ts.map,js.map} 2> /dev/null",
|
||
|
"build:release": "cd build && npm i && npm run build",
|
||
|
"format": "prettier --write 'src/**/*.{js,ts}' 'test/*.js'",
|
||
|
"lint": "prettier --check 'src/**/*.{js,ts}' 'test/*.js'",
|
||
|
"test": "node test/index.test.js"
|
||
|
},
|
||
|
"sideEffects": false,
|
||
|
"version": "1.4.2"
|
||
|
}
|